Jeremy Clarkson gets really riled in Round the Bend

What's it like to drive a car that's actively trying to kill you?

This and many other burning questions trouble Jeremy Clarkson as he sets out to explore the world from the safety of four wheels. Avoiding the legions of power-crazed traffic wombles attempting to block highway and byway, he:

• Shows how the world of performance cars may be likened to Battersea Dogs' Home
• Reveals why St Moritz may be the most bonkers town in all of the world
• Reminds us that Switzerland is so afraid of snow that any flakes falling on the road are immediately arrested
• Argues that washing a car is a waste of time

Funny, globe-trotting, irreverent and sometimes downright rude, Round the Bend is packed with curious and fascinating but otherwise hopelessly useless stories and facts about everything under the sun (and just occasionally cars). It's Jeremy Clarkson at his brilliant best.

Round the Bend is a collection of Jeremy's motoring journalism from his column in the Sunday Times.
